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

DECOHACK-Defined Sprite Translucency #2013

Open
OpenRift412 opened this issue Nov 10, 2024 · 1 comment
Open

DECOHACK-Defined Sprite Translucency #2013

OpenRift412 opened this issue Nov 10, 2024 · 1 comment

Comments

@OpenRift412
Copy link

I've mentioned this before in the Woof channel in the Chocolate Doom Discord, but I'll put it here so it can be tracked.

In Legacy of Rust, certain sprites have a transparency effect applied to them (Ghoul projectile, Vassago Flame, Incinerator Flame, and Heatwave Ripper) which are defined in the WAD's DECOHACK lump. I don't know how much work would need to be done to implement DECOHACK support, but I think it will be ultimately worth it in regards to having author-definable transparency for specific sprites.

@rfomin
Copy link
Collaborator

rfomin commented Nov 11, 2024

DECOHACK is translated to standard DEHACKED using DoomTools. The Transluencsy flag in DEHACKED is a Boom feature that is supported in Woof. The difference is that Boom/Woof defines most projectiles as translucent, while the KEX port does not.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ants